Hi Jp,
  The stereo line out will plug straight into your Stereo's line in, if it
has line in.  You may need to get the appropriate cable with RCA plugs for
the stereo.   There are a number of different RCA convertor plugs that can
be used at the other end to connect it to your new toy.
  Its a good approach for practicing at home.
